Once a year suits most households. Large families, pet bedding, and long duct runs load lint faster, so twice a year is reasonable. If drying time has crept up over recent months, that is your real signal, regardless of the calendar.
Yes. Lint is dry tinder, and a blocked duct traps heat right where the burner or element sits. Most dryers have safety cutoffs, but those parts fail. Clearing the duct removes the fuel and lets heat leave the house.
It can be. Every foot of duct and every elbow adds resistance the blower has to overcome. Long runs through attics or crawlspaces also collect condensation in humid weather, which glues lint to the walls faster.
Rigid or semi-rigid metal is the better choice. Thin foil and plastic accordion hose kink easily when the dryer is pushed back, and the ridges catch lint. We swap crushed transitions during a visit when needed.
